DEAIMS 2)e 2 t GltasdeA. Q. Slud eA. As dean of the college, Dr. Shatzer’s duties bring him into direct contact not only with the problems of individual students, but also those of administration. For forty-one years he has been associated with Wittenberg faculty, the last twenty-seven as dean. He received his A.B. from Wittenberg, and the degree of Sc.D. from Susquehanna University. He is coordinator of Civil Aex-onautics Administration of the college and Springfield Air Service. At present he is working on a revision of Wittenberg’s curriculum in an effort to accelerate the program. Believes firmly that the college curriculum must fit the students, not vice-versa. ubeatt (lidk DmmelL A model of quiet graciousness as well as of the efficiency of the modern woman is Miss Ruth Immell, dean of women. Her wisdom and experience has, for almost two dec- ades, been a source of help and of inspiration to campus women. Both her degrees, A.B. and A.M., came from the University of Pennsylvania. Freshman Orientation, classes, chair- man of the Alma Mater committee, sponsor for W.W.L., Pan-Hellenic Council, Y.W.C.A., and Arrow and Mask are a few of her regular duties. She belongs to the American Wom- en’s Volunteer Service, believing that women can help with defense program in many ways. Morale, she says, is a woman’s problem. fe, cJt. PefiAltutcj, For more than fifteen years, Dr. Pershing has been advising undergraduate Witten- bergers in his capacity as dean of students. Unfailing in helpful ideas, perspicacious in personality, he has been an ever-ready source of sound advice when the student needs it. He has constantly maintained an active interest in the extra-curricular activities and is advisor to numerous campus organizations. Dean Pershing received his A.B. from Wit- tenberg, his B.D. from Hamma. The University of Pittsburgh awarded his A.M., Chicago University his Ph.D. His D.D. degree came from Thiel. In the past year he has served as chairman of the college Committee for Defense. Shatzer Immell Pershing Page Nine
